E-filing systems are digital platforms designed to facilitate the submission, management, and storage of documents and data electronically. They are commonly used by government agencies, tax authorities, legal bodies, and organizations to streamline processes such as tax filing, legal document submission, or official record keeping, replacing traditional paper-based methods with efficient, secure online solutions.

Key Features

  • Secure login and user authentication
  • Intuitive user interface for easy navigation
  • Automated form filling and validation
  • Data encryption and cybersecurity measures
  • Real-time processing and updates
  • Integration with other digital systems and databases
  • Electronic signature capabilities
  • Automated reminders and notifications
  • Audit trail and compliance tracking

Pros

  • Significantly reduces paperwork and manual effort
  • Speeds up processing times for submissions and approvals
  • Enhances data accuracy through validation tools
  • Increases convenience by allowing submission from anywhere with internet access
  • Improves data security with encryption and access controls

Cons

  • Initial setup costs and infrastructure requirements can be high
  • Learning curve for users unfamiliar with digital systems
  • Technical issues or downtime can disrupt processes
  • Potential security vulnerabilities if not properly maintained
  • Limited accessibility for users in areas with poor internet connectivity
